<div>Don&#8217;t really need of ipv6 to be run on your server. Want to disable it ?</div>
<p><span id="more-163"></span>Just run the following syntax&#8230;</p>
<p><em><span style="color: #993300">Make sure no such entries inside: </span></em><strong><em><span style="color: #333300">/etc/sysconfig/network</span></em></strong><em><span style="color: #993300"> and </span></em><strong><em><span style="color: #333300">/etc/modprobe.conf</span></em></strong><em><span style="color: #993300"> file <img src='http://blog.nataprawira.com/tech/wp-includes/images/smilies/icon_smile.gif' alt=':)' class='wp-smiley' /> </span></em></p>
<blockquote><p># echo &#8220;NETWORKING_IPV6=no&#8221; &gt;&gt; /etc/sysconfig/network<br />
# echo &#8220;alias ipv6 off&#8221; &gt;&gt; /etc/modprobe.conf<br />
# echo &#8220;alias net-pf-10 off&#8221; &gt;&gt; /etc/modprobe.conf<br />
# reboot <span style="color: #0000ff"> </span><em><span style="color: #0000ff">(your server to make affect)</span></em></p></blockquote>
<p>Once reboot-ed, do :</p>
<p># ifconfig</p>
<blockquote><p>eth1      Link encap:Ethernet  HWaddr 00:1C:F0:BB:A7:28<br />
inet addr:10.10.10.11  Bcast:10.10.10.255  Mask:255.255.255.0<br />
UP BROADCAST RUNNING MULTICAST  MTU:1500  Metric:1<br />
RX packets:470471884 errors:1 dropped:0 overruns:0 frame:0<br />
TX packets:464109169 errors:0 dropped:0 overruns:0 carrier:0<br />
collisions:0 txqueuelen:1000<br />
RX bytes:2574513731 (2.3 GiB)  TX bytes:2255015395 (2.1 GiB)<br />
Interrupt:225 Base address:0&#215;2800</p></blockquote>

<h3 style="font-family: 'Trebuchet MS', 'Lucida Grande', Verdana, Arial, sans-serif;font-weight: bold;font-size: 1.3em;color: #333333;text-decoration: none;margin-top: 30px;margin-right: 0px;margin-bottom: 0px;margin-left: 0px;padding: 0px"><span style="color: #000000;font-family: Georgia, 'Times New Roman', 'Bitstream Charter', Times, serif;font-weight: normal;font-size: 13px"><strong>0) Backup your database.<br />
</strong>You should probably be doing this already.  Now’s a good time to make sure that your backups ran.</span></h3>
<p><span style="color: #000000;font-family: Georgia, 'Times New Roman', 'Bitstream Charter', Times, serif;font-weight: normal;font-size: 13px"> </span></p>
<p><strong>1) Create the script.<br />
</strong>You’ll need the correct permissions to query the database. Here’s the command.  Be sure to change &lt;DATABASE_NAME&gt; as it fits.</p>
<p><code style="font: normal normal normal 1.1em/normal 'Courier New', Courier, Fixed"><strong><span style="color: #0000ff"># mysql -p -e "show tables in &lt;DATABASE_NAME&gt;;" | \<br />
tail --lines=+2 | \<br />
xargs -i echo "ALTER TABLE {} ENGINE=INNODB;" &gt; alter_table.sql</span></strong></code></p>
<p><strong>2) Run the script</strong>.</p>
<p><code style="font: normal normal normal 1.1em/normal 'Courier New', Courier, Fixed"><strong><span style="color: #0000ff"># mysql --database=&lt;DATABASE_NAME&gt; -p &lt; alter_table.sql</span></strong></code></p>
<p><strong>3) Verify</strong> it by running this command in mysql:</p>
<p><code style="font: normal normal normal 1.1em/normal 'Courier New', Courier, Fixed"><strong><span style="color: #0000ff">mysql&gt; show table status;</span></strong></code></p>

<h2><span style="font-weight: normal;font-size: 13px">This is a quick walk through on how to set up domain keys on Centos 5 using sendmail. It should also be very similar for Redhat or Fedora.</span></h2>
<div>
<p>Domainkeys is a method mostly used by yahoo to verify that the sender of an email is valid. I did notice that gmail changes the domainkeys header line to a pass value but I don’t know if they block/accept mail based on that.<span id="more-140"></span></p>
<p>First install some dependencies.</p>
<blockquote><p><strong>yum install sendmail-devel openssl-devel</strong></p></blockquote>
<p>First download the latest version of dk-milter by going to http://sourceforge.net/projects/dk-milter/</p>
<blockquote><p><strong>cd /usr/src/<br />
wget http://downloads.sourceforge.net/dk-milter/dk-milter-1.0.0.tar.gz</strong></p></blockquote>
<p>Then extract it using the command</p>
<blockquote><p><strong>tar xzf dk-milter-1.0.0.tar.gz<br />
cd dk-milter-2.6.0</strong></p></blockquote>
<p>Start by copying the sample config file to the proper directory and the make/make installing</p>
<blockquote><p><strong>cp site.config.m4.dist devtools/Site/site.config.m4<br />
make; make install</strong></p>
<p><span> </span></p></blockquote>
<p>You may see a few errors during the install, as long as they are just about creating the man pages you should be alright. Now change back to a good working directory and create your new keys.</p>
<blockquote><p><strong>cd ~/ssl-gen<br />
openssl genrsa -out rsa.private 768<br />
openssl rsa -in rsa.private -out rsa.public -pubout -outform PEM</strong></p></blockquote>
<p>Make the directory and move the private key into it.</p>
<blockquote><p><strong>mkdir -p /var/db/domainkeys/<br />
cp rsa.private /var/db/domainkeys/mail.key.pem</strong></p></blockquote>
<p>Now we should set up our DNS TXT records with our public key. This is how it should look in a bind zone file. Put the public key only and not the “BEGIN RSA PRIVATE…” or “END RSA…” parts of the key with out parenthesis.</p>
<blockquote><p><strong>mail._domainkey.jkurtzman.com.         IN TXT  “k=rsa; t=y; p=(Paste the public key here)”<br />
_domainkey.jkurtzman.com.                 IN TXT  “t=y; o=~”</strong></p></blockquote>
<p>You can use the following command to verify that your TXT record was set up correctly.</p>
<blockquote><p><strong>dig +short mail._domainkey.jkurtzman.com TXT</strong></p></blockquote>
<p>Now we will need to make the init script so the it starts when the computer reboots. Put the following into a file called <strong>/etc/init.d/domainkeys</strong>. Of course be sure to change the domain to your own domain. Remember to fix any lines that have wrapped when copying. Especially the COMMAND line.</p>
<blockquote><p><strong>#!/bin/sh<br />
#<br />
# “/etc/rc.d/init.d/dk-filter”<br />
# Start/stop script for the dk-filter daemon on RedHat Linux<br />
#<br />
# chkconfig: – 79 31<br />
# description: Acts as the “dk-filter” InputMailFilter (milter) for the \<br />
# Sendmail MTA to provide DomainKeys service</strong></p>
<p><strong>############################################################<br />
#<br />
# Be sure to edit these values:<br />
#<br />
KEYFILE=”/var/db/domainkeys/mail.key.pem”<br />
DOMAIN=”jkurtzman.com”<br />
SELECTOR=”mail”<br />
USER=”domainkeys”<br />
#<br />
############################################################</strong></p>
<p><strong>PIDFILE=”/var/run/dk-milter/pid”<br />
SUBMISSION_DAEMON=”smtp”<br />
PORT=8891</strong></p>
<p><strong># Source function library. Provides the “status” option<br />
. /etc/init.d/functions</strong></p>
<p><strong>test -x `which dk-filter` || exit 0</strong></p>
<p><strong>RETVAL=0</strong></p>
<p><strong>start() {<br />
echo -n $”Starting dk-filter: ”<br />
COMMAND=”dk-filter -u $USER -b s -p inet:$PORT@localhost -l -P $PIDFILE -s $KEYFILE -d $DOMAIN -S $SELECTOR -m$SUBMISSION_DAEMON -c nofws”<br />
# echo -e “Now executing\n”$COMMAND”&#8221;<br />
daemon $COMMAND<br />
RETVAL=$?<br />
echo<br />
[ $RETVAL -eq 0 ] &amp;&amp; touch /var/lock/subsys/dk-filter<br />
return $RETVAL<br />
}</strong></p>
<p><strong>stop() {<br />
echo -n $”Stopping dk-filter: ”<br />
killproc dk-filter<br />
RETVAL=$?<br />
echo<br />
[ $RETVAL -eq 0 ] &amp;&amp; rm -f $PIDFILE /var/lock/subsys/dk-filter<br />
return $RETVAL<br />
}</strong></p>
<p><strong>restart() {<br />
stop<br />
start<br />
}</strong></p>
<p><strong>case “$1″ in<br />
start)<br />
start<br />
;;<br />
stop)<br />
stop<br />
;;<br />
status)<br />
status dk-filter<br />
;;<br />
restart)<br />
restart<br />
;;<br />
*)<br />
echo $”Usage: $0 {start|stop|status|restart}”<br />
exit 1<br />
esac</strong></p>
<p><strong>exit $?</strong></p></blockquote>
<p>Give your new file execute permisions, create a user for domain keys to run as, and start it</p>
<blockquote><p><strong>chmod +x /etc/init.d/domainkeys<br />
useradd domainkeys<br />
service domainkeys start</strong></p></blockquote>
<p>If everything work you should see that the dk-filter has started.<br />
Now run chkconfig so the service starts when you reboot.</p>
<blockquote><p><strong>chkconfig domainkeys on</strong></p></blockquote>
<p>Now add this to your /etc/mail/sendmail.mc file.</p>
<blockquote><p><strong>INPUT_MAIL_FILTER(`dk-filter’, `S=inet:8891@localhost’)</strong></p></blockquote>
<p>And make and restart sendmail.</p>
<blockquote><p><strong>cd /etc/mail<br />
make<br />
service sendmail restart</strong></p></blockquote>
<p>You should now be able to send email and be domainkey verified. If you are relaying mail through the mail server you will need to make sure you are using SMTP Authentication otherwise the  dk-filter will not add the header information.</p>
<p>Try sending an email to a yahoo account and see if you get secure icon.</p>
